David Lynch: MIDFIELD IS IRAOLA'S BIGGEST PUZZLE! | Newcastle 2-2 Liverpool Reaction

Liverpool scored a 99th-minute equaliser to snatch a point from a trip to Newcastle United in their Premier League opener. Dominik Szoboszlai's penalty was the key goal after Cody Gakpo had also earlier equalised. And Reds reporter David Lynch believes it was a game that featured plenty of positives and negatives for the visitors to think upon. Here, he discusses the midfield balance issues that are likely to define the early part of Iraola's reign. The important contributions of new signings Jeremy Jacquet and Victor Munoz are also touched upon. Opinion Divided on Trent, and Newcastle Excitement

Opinion Divided on Trent, and Newcastle Excitement

Dave Davis talks about Trent Alexander-Arnold’s struggles under José Mourinho have sparked talk of a Liverpool return. A permanent transfer appears unlikely, but a loan could address Liverpool’s right-back and ball-progression problems—if supporters can forgive his departure. Ismaïla Sarr has been linked with Galatasaray and Liverpool. Dave Davis dismisses an Anfield move, arguing that the 28-year-old’s opportunity has passed and hoping Liverpool will no longer have to face their familiar tormentor. Liverpool face an emotional, hostile opener at Newcastle. Frimpong is expected at right-back, with Wirtz, Szoboszlai and Gravenberch in midfield.
